GPO |
|
Contact details
|
The historic and heritage-listed Melbourne General Post Office reopened in 2004 as a fashion, food and shopping precinct. The GPO features some of the best names in fashion and Melbourne's newest food precinct.

Lygon Street Carlton |
|
Contact details
|
In the heart of Carlton, discover the internationally renowned Lygon Street where wining, dining, caffe lattes and Italian delicacies are a feature. Italian restaurants spill on to the footpaths in this historic heartland of Melbourne's Italian community.

Southbank Arts and Leisure Centre |
|
Contact details
|
A unique leisure destination that offers unparalleled views of the Yarra River and an eclectic mix of dining and shopping. Take a stroll along the promenade, watch street theatre, enjoy a sumptuous meal or watch the city skyline light up over a glass of wine. The Sunday market showcases over 150 stalls of Victoria's finest arts and crafts.
